Ariocarpus agavoides berries
I've never succeeded in getting these to fruit before, though they have flowered the past two years. I had them from Christer about four years ago in a swap.
This is a very up-tight sort of plant, but the green berry can just be seen. The next one is more laid-back, and the berry has ripened already:
